#import "ImageAndTextCell.h"
50
//#import "BaseNode.h"
51

    
52
@implementation ImageAndTextCell
53

    
54
#define kIconImageSize		16.0
55

    
56
#define kImageOriginXOffset 3
57
#define kImageOriginYOffset 1
58

    
59
#define kTextOriginXOffset	2
60
#define kTextOriginYOffset	2
61
#define kTextHeightAdjust	4
62

    
63
// -------------------------------------------------------------------------------
64
//	init:
65
// -------------------------------------------------------------------------------
66
- (id)init
67
{
68
	self = [super init];
69
	
70
	// we want a smaller font
71
	[self setFont:[NSFont systemFontOfSize:[NSFont smallSystemFontSize]]];
72

    
73
	return self;
74
}
75

    
76
// -------------------------------------------------------------------------------
77
//	dealloc:
78
// -------------------------------------------------------------------------------
79
- (void)dealloc
80
{
81
    [image release];
82
    image = nil;
83
    [super dealloc];
84
}
85

    
86
// -------------------------------------------------------------------------------
87
//	copyWithZone:zone
88
// -------------------------------------------------------------------------------
89
- (id)copyWithZone:(NSZone*)zone
90
{
91
    ImageAndTextCell *cell = (ImageAndTextCell*)[super copyWithZone:zone];
92
    cell->image = [image retain];
93
    return cell;
94
}
95

    
96
// -------------------------------------------------------------------------------
97
//	setImage:anImage
98
// -------------------------------------------------------------------------------
99
- (void)setImage:(NSImage*)anImage
100
{
101
    if (anImage != image)
102
	{
103
        [image release];
104
        image = [anImage retain];
105
		[image setSize:NSMakeSize(kIconImageSize, kIconImageSize)];
106
    }
107
}
108

    
109
// -------------------------------------------------------------------------------
110
//	image:
111
// -------------------------------------------------------------------------------
112
- (NSImage*)image
113
{
114
    return image;
115
}
116

    
117
// -------------------------------------------------------------------------------
118
//	isGroupCell:
119
// -------------------------------------------------------------------------------
120
- (BOOL)isGroupCell
121
{
122
    return ([self image] == nil && [[self title] length] > 0);
123
}
124

    
125
// -------------------------------------------------------------------------------
126
//	titleRectForBounds:cellRect
127
//
128
//	Returns the proper bound for the cell's title while being edited
129
// -------------------------------------------------------------------------------
130
- (NSRect)titleRectForBounds:(NSRect)cellRect
131
{	
132
	// the cell has an image: draw the normal item cell
133
	NSSize imageSize;
134
	NSRect imageFrame;
135

    
136
	imageSize = [image size];
137
	NSDivideRect(cellRect, &imageFrame, &cellRect, 3 + imageSize.width, NSMinXEdge);
138

    
139
	imageFrame.origin.x += kImageOriginXOffset;
140
	imageFrame.origin.y -= kImageOriginYOffset;
141
	imageFrame.size = imageSize;
142
	
143
	imageFrame.origin.y += ceil((cellRect.size.height - imageFrame.size.height) / 2);
144
	
145
	NSRect newFrame = cellRect;
146
	newFrame.origin.x += kTextOriginXOffset;
147
	newFrame.origin.y += kTextOriginYOffset;
148
	newFrame.size.height -= kTextHeightAdjust;
149

    
150
	return newFrame;
151
}
152

    
153
// -------------------------------------------------------------------------------
154
//	editWithFrame:inView:editor:delegate:event
155
// -------------------------------------------------------------------------------
156
- (void)editWithFrame:(NSRect)aRect inView:(NSView*)controlView editor:(NSText*)textObj delegate:(id)anObject event:(NSEvent*)theEvent
157
{
158
	NSRect textFrame = [self titleRectForBounds:aRect];
159
	[super editWithFrame:textFrame inView:controlView editor:textObj delegate:anObject event:theEvent];
160
}
161

    
162
// -------------------------------------------------------------------------------
163
//	selectWithFrame:inView:editor:delegate:event:start:length
164
// -------------------------------------------------------------------------------
165
- (void)selectWithFrame:(NSRect)aRect inView:(NSView *)controlView editor:(NSText *)textObj delegate:(id)anObject start:(NSInteger)selStart length:(NSInteger)selLength
166
{
167
	NSRect textFrame = [self titleRectForBounds:aRect];
168
	[super selectWithFrame:textFrame inView:controlView editor:textObj delegate:anObject start:selStart length:selLength];
169
}
170

    
171
// -------------------------------------------------------------------------------
172
//	drawWithFrame:cellFrame:controlView:
173
// -------------------------------------------------------------------------------
174
- (void)drawWithFrame:(NSRect)cellFrame inView:(NSView*)controlView
175
{
176
	if (image != nil)
177
	{
178
		// the cell has an image: draw the normal item cell
179
		NSSize imageSize;
180
        NSRect imageFrame;
181

    
182
        imageSize = [image size];
183
        NSDivideRect(cellFrame, &imageFrame, &cellFrame, 3 + imageSize.width, NSMinXEdge);
184
 
185
        imageFrame.origin.x += kImageOriginXOffset;
186
		imageFrame.origin.y -= kImageOriginYOffset;
187
        imageFrame.size = imageSize;
188
		
189
        if ([controlView isFlipped])
190
            imageFrame.origin.y += ceil((cellFrame.size.height + imageFrame.size.height) / 2);
191
        else
192
            imageFrame.origin.y += ceil((cellFrame.size.height - imageFrame.size.height) / 2);
193
		[image compositeToPoint:imageFrame.origin operation:NSCompositeSourceOver];
194

    
195
		NSRect newFrame = cellFrame;
196
		newFrame.origin.x += kTextOriginXOffset;
197
		newFrame.origin.y += kTextOriginYOffset;
198
		newFrame.size.height -= kTextHeightAdjust;
199
		[super drawWithFrame:newFrame inView:controlView];
200
    }
201
	else
202
	{
203
		if ([self isGroupCell])
204
		{
205
			// Center the text in the cellFrame, and call super to do thew ork of actually drawing. 
206
			CGFloat yOffset = floor((NSHeight(cellFrame) - [[self attributedStringValue] size].height) / 2.0);
207
			cellFrame.origin.y += yOffset;
208
			cellFrame.size.height -= (kTextOriginYOffset*yOffset);
209
			[super drawWithFrame:cellFrame inView:controlView];
210
		}
211
	}
212
}
213

    
214
// -------------------------------------------------------------------------------
215
//	cellSize:
216
// -------------------------------------------------------------------------------
217
- (NSSize)cellSize
218
{
219
    NSSize cellSize = [super cellSize];
220
    cellSize.width += (image ? [image size].width : 0) + 3;
221
    return cellSize;
222
}
223

    
224
// -------------------------------------------------------------------------------
225
//	hitTestForEvent:
226
//
227
//	In 10.5, we need you to implement this method for blocking drag and drop of a given cell.
228
//	So NSCell hit testing will determine if a row can be dragged or not.
229
//
230
//	NSTableView calls this cell method when starting a drag, if the hit cell returns
231
//	NSCellHitTrackableArea, the particular row will be tracked instead of dragged.
232
//
233
// -------------------------------------------------------------------------------
234
//- (NSUInteger)hitTestForEvent:(NSEvent *)event inRect:(NSRect)cellFrame ofView:(NSView *)controlView
235
//{
236
//	NSInteger result = NSCellHitContentArea;
237
//	
238
//	NSOutlineView* hostingOutlineView = (NSOutlineView*)[self controlView];
239
//	if (hostingOutlineView)
240
//	{
241
//		NSInteger selectedRow = [hostingOutlineView selectedRow];
242
//		BaseNode* node = [[hostingOutlineView itemAtRow:selectedRow] representedObject];
243
//
244
//		if (![node isDraggable])	// is the node isDraggable (i.e. non-file system based objects)
245
//			result = NSCellHitTrackableArea;
246
//	}
247
//		
248
//	return result;
249
//}
250

    
251
@end
